Michigan Radio Rebrands as Michigan Public
Michigan Radio, the state’s largest NPR news outlet, is rebranding and changing its name to Michigan Public. The rebrand reflects the station’s goal of meeting people where they are: on the radio, online, on mobile devices, on-demand and in-person at events. This name change was effective Wednesday, January 10, 2024.

This past December, the FCC opened a filing window for new Low-Power FM (LPFM) stations nationwide. All-in-all, 1,336 applications for the non-commercial service were filed with the FCC December 6-13, 2023. This includes 32 applications within the State of Michigan.

WDET-FM/Detroit Public Radio has announced a partnership with Gongwer News Service to further enhance the weekly state politics podcast, MichMash. Hosted by award-winning podcaster and journalist Cheyna Roth, MichMash has a reputation for unraveling the intricacies of the state’s political landscape.
